are you listening to lots of French content? exposure to the language helps, you'll slowly become accustomed to the different/foreign sounds
to practice pronunciation, you'll need to first listen then do your best to imitate what you hear
so replay the video or recording to listen again and again to that word you want to practice, then try to pronounce out loud what you hear
to the best of your ability
